Our man on the ground in Kenya, Andy Arnold was granted exclusive access to Kwemoi last week as the ninth-fastest man of all time (3:28.81 pb) prepares for his first Olympics. His coach, Renato Canova, would not be surprised if the 20-year-old Kwemoi, who beat Kiprop and several of the world's top milers in Monaco on July 15, one day breaks the world records at 1,500 or 5,000 meters.
